What costs should I expect beyond rent in a Hialeah townhome community?

Watch for a community application fee, sometimes a tenant amenity or gate-access charge, and occasionally a refundable common-area deposit — all set by the association rather than the landlord. None is large on its own, but together they matter at signing, and we lay out the complete move-in cost before you apply.

Can I bring a dog to a Hialeah townhome rental?

You need two yeses: the owner's and the association's. Community rules can restrict breed, weight and how many animals a household keeps, and those rules bind tenants no matter what the landlord privately allows. What is a realistic timeline for landing a rental in Hialeah?

Plan on roughly two weeks from application to keys for a straightforward annual lease — application, deposits, approvals. Buildings governed by a condo association add a board approval on their own calendar, and some boards move slowly.
